What does Alannah mean?

Alannah is a girl name of Irish (Gaelic) origin meaning “O my child, or rock”. From the Irish endearment a leanbh, also a feminine of Alan.

How common is Alannah?

Recorded births named Alannah by country
CountryBirths on record
United States since 18807,392 births
England & Wales since 19962,260 births
Scotland since 1974452 births
Northern Ireland since 1997286 births
Ireland since 19642,781 births

Counts come from official national birth-registration statistics: U.S. Social Security Administration, England & Wales (Office for National Statistics), Scotland (National Records of Scotland), Northern Ireland (NISRA), Ireland (Central Statistics Office) and New Zealand (Dept. of Internal Affairs). Coverage spans differ, so totals aren't directly comparable across countries.

How popular is Alannah?

Alannah is an uncommon baby name in the United States. It was most common in 2015, when it ranked #1,438 nationally (given to 554 babies that year).
